nl.phhsnews.com


nl.phhsnews.com / Wat zijn de stappen om het openbare IP-adres van een computer te vinden?

Wat zijn de stappen om het openbare IP-adres van een computer te vinden?


Toegang krijgen tot een service om uw openbare IP-adres te achterhalen, kan erg nuttig zijn, maar hoe werkt het proces? De SuperUser Q & A-post van vandaag biedt het antwoord op de vraag van een nieuwsgierige lezer. De vraag- en antwoordsessie van vandaag komt tot ons dankzij SuperUser - een onderdeel van Stack Exchange, een gemeenschapsgedreven groep van Q & A-websites.

Screenshot met dank aan Douglas Porter (Flickr).

De vraag

SuperUser-lezer Harry wil weten wat de stappen zijn om het openbare IP-adres van een computer te vinden:

Ik ben op de hoogte van services zoals What Is My IP Address waarmee een gebruiker om hun openbare IP-adres te vinden, maar wat ik zou willen weten, is hoe een dergelijke service van nul wordt geschreven? Ik heb de code zelf niet nodig, ik wil alleen de concepten en de bijbehorende stappen kennen (pseudo-code als je dat wilt).

Dit is wat ik al weet over het maken van een dergelijke service:

Ik zou een webtoepassing op internet die naar / voor poort 80 luistert.

  1. Wanneer een verzoek binnenkomt, zou ik het bron-IP-adres onderzoeken en dat dan in een mooi geformatteerd HTML-antwoord verpakken zodat de gebruiker het kan zien.
  2. Is dat of is hier nog iets anders mee gemoeid?

Wat zijn de stappen om het openbare IP-adres van een computer te vinden?

Het antwoord

SuperUser-bijdrager Scott Chamberlain heeft het antwoord voor ons:

Voor het grootste deel is wat u hebt opgesomd, alles wat u hoeft te doen voor basisfunctionaliteit.

Er is echter nog iets dat u zou kunnen doen. U kunt de header

X-Forwarded-For die door sommige proxies (de soort die voor caching wordt gebruikt) en / of load balancers wordt toegevoegd en dat adres rapporteren, omdat het adres dat u van het bronadres krijgt, de proxy's zijn adres, niet die van de gebruiker. Die header is echter door de gebruiker verstrekt, dus er is geen manier om aan te tonen dat het adres in

X-Forwarded-For het echte bronadres van de gebruiker is. Heeft u iets toe te voegen aan de uitleg? Geluid uit in de reacties. Wilt u meer antwoorden van andere technisch onderlegde Stack Exchange-gebruikers lezen? Bekijk hier de volledige discussiethread



HTG Reviews De Wink Hub: Geef je Smarthome een brein zonder de bank te breken

HTG Reviews De Wink Hub: Geef je Smarthome een brein zonder de bank te breken

Een huis vol met slimme apparaten is geweldig, maar het beheren van ze allemaal op een soepele en uniforme manier kan een nachtmerrie zijn : voer de domotica-hub in. Lees verder terwijl we de Wink Hub testen en laten zien hoe u uw apparaten kunt laten samenwerken. Wat is de Wink Hub? Wink is een slim platform voor thuis / domotica, gecreëerd door een samenwerking tussen Quirky en GE om beheer en beheer slimme thuisproducten gemaakt door de partnerbedrijven.

(how-to)

Hoe Key Repeating in macOS inschakelen

Hoe Key Repeating in macOS inschakelen

Zoals iedereen die een Mac gebruikt weet, is het invoeren van speciale tekens heel eenvoudig: u hoeft alleen maar een letter ingedrukt te houden. Dat is geweldig als je Pokémon Go met je vrienden mañana wilt spelen, maar niet zo heel veel als je nu wilt spelen. GERELATEERD: Speciale tekens in OS X invoeren in twee sneltoetsen Normaal gesproken, op macOS, wanneer je een toets ingedrukt houdt, verschijnt er een pop-up waarmee je een speciaal teken kunt kiezen als er aan die bepaalde toets is toegewezen.

(how-to)